Have you ever considered the benefits of boxing fitness? If you don’t know what I’m talking about, think Tae Bo. This boxing fitness craze helped thrust fitness boxing into the whole fitness limelight. Even though Tae Bo is a type of kickboxing, it still carries many of the qualities that other boxing fitness activities have. I once knew an amateur boxer who used boxing as a form of exercise as well; I learned a great deal about fitness boxing by working with him. He was hooked on the activity and used it to keep fit and trim. He told me about the diligence this type of training required and he reminded me about all the hours those who engaged in boxing spent in the ring each day. He showed me all about the cardiovascular work involved in boxing fitness and I was amazed. Boxing is clearly superior to most of the martial arts activities and programs one can engage in.
